Bud Dry Draft: A Test Can from Anheuser-Busch

This page documents a test can for Bud Dry Draft beer, produced by Anheuser-Busch in St. Louis, Missouri. While Bud Dry itself was a nationally distributed beer from 1990 to 2010, this particular can represents a pre-release test market phase. These test cans are highly sought after by collectors for their rarity and historical significance in the development of Bud Dry's product line.
